one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the net wherein a protracted URL may be transformed right into a shorter, a lot more workable form. This shortened URL redirects to the first very long URL when frequented.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-recognized sam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the advent of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, where by character limitations for posts made it challenging to share lengthy URLs.

2. Core Factors of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ually includes the following components:

Internet Interface: Here is the front-end aspect in which people can enter their very long URLs and obtain shortened versions. It might be an easy type over a Web content.
Database: A database is essential to retail store the mapping concerning the first very long URL as well as the shortened Variation.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that requires the limited URL and redirects the user for the corresponding prolonged URL. This logic is generally applied in the internet server or an application layer.
API: Many URL shorteners provide an API to ensure 3rd-social gathering ap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ial extended UR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a long URL into a brief a single. Numerous strategies might be used, such as:

Hashing: The long URL can be hashed into a fixed-dimension string, which serves because the small URL. Nevertheless, hash collisions (distinct URLs leading to a similar h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A single prevalent tactic is to employ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two figures: 0-nine, A-Z, and a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ry inside the databases. This process makes certain that the shorter URL is as brief as you possibly can.
Random String Era: A different tactic is usually to produce a random string of a fixed size (e.g., 6 figures) and Look at if it’s currently in use while in the databases. Otherwise, it’s assigned to your prolonged URL.
four. Databases Administration
The databases schema for just a URL shortener is often easy, with two Major fields:

ID: A unique identifier for every UR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The original URL that should be shortened.
Quick URL/Slug: The shorter Edition with the URL, frequently saved as a novel string.
In addition to these, you might like to store metadata like the development day, expiration day, and the volume of times the brief URL has become accessed.

five. Managing Redirection
Redirection is a essential A part of the URL shortener's Procedure. Every time a person clicks on a brief URL, the assistance really should quickly retrieve the first URL in the database and redirect the person employing an HTTP 301 (permanent redirect) or 302 (short-term redirect) status code.

Effectiveness is key below, as the process really should be practically instantaneous. Procedures like database indexing and caching (e.g., applying Redis or Memcached) could be used to speed up the retrieval method.

six. Security Factors
Protection is a significant problem in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ener is usually abused to spread mal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-celebration safety expert services to examine URLs before shortening them can mitigate this threat.
Spam Prevention: Fee restricting and CAPTCHA can reduce abuse by spammers trying to produce A huge number of limited URLs.
seven.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might need to deal with an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, potentially invol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ted traffic throughout a number of servers to manage substantial masses.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Separate f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inctive products and services to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ners frequently offer analytics to trace how frequently a short URL is clicked, exactly where the tra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This demands logging each red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
